About Barnes County, North Dakota
Barnes County, North Dakota has a total population of 10,773, making it the 2,434th most populous county in the United States. The median age in Barnes County is 43.5 years, which is 11.8% above the national median of 38.9 years.
The median household income in Barnes County is $68,038, which ranks #1,339 of 3,222 counties nationwide. This is 9.5% below the national median of $75,149. The poverty rate is 12.1%, lower than the national rate of 12.6%. The unemployment rate stands at 3.8%.
The median home value in Barnes County is $173,700, 38.4% below the national median. Renters in Barnes County pay a median gross rent of $779 per month. The homeownership rate is 70.8%, compared to the national rate of 64.4%.
In Barnes County, 30.7%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her, 9.0% below the national average of 33.7%. Health insurance coverage stands at 95.5% of the population. The average commute time for workers is 21.5 min.
Barnes County is a diverse community. The largest racial or ethnic group is White (non-Hispanic) at 89.4% of the population, followed by Two or More Races (4.5%) and Hispanic or Latino (2.1%).
All data for Barnes County, North Dakota comes from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ates. These figures are estimates based on survey sampling and are subject to margin of error. For the most detailed and up-to-date data, visit the Census Bureau's official data portal.
